Haste Rating Bugged?

Currently Haste rating doesnt addativly stack with it self (unless im real dumb).

Using Dragonstrike on my warrior without any attackspeed increases (flurry, mongoose etc) I gain 212 haste rating which on my character pane says 13.44%. That changes my attackspeed to 2.38. This is a 11.85% increase in attackspeed. This equals about 17.9 rating per 1% haste.

Now if I proc my T5 4set tank bonus on top of that I gain an additional 200 haste. Now i have 26.13% haste according to my character pane. At this point my MH attackspeed is 2.14, a 20.74% attackspeed increase. This equates to about 19.86 rating per 1% haste.

Now to my knowledge haste rating should not be exponentially declining in value, at least at low amounts.

The formula is weapon speed / (( haste / 100)+1) = as opposed to what you used aka weapon speed * 0.8656 and later weapon speed * 0.7387.

If you use the proper one then 2.7 / ( 26.13 / 100)+1) = 2.7/1.2613 = 2.1406

Haste works perfectly fine. You’re confusing attack speed increase(haste) with time between attacks.

Now i have 26.13% haste according to my character pane. At this point my MH attackspeed is 2.14, a 20.74% attackspeed increase.

1/1.2613 = 0.7928…

When your attack speed increases by 26.13%, your time between attacks goes down by 20.72%(obviously there are some decimals missing on the 2.14 attack speed)

Let’s imagine you have 100% haste if you want an easier example…

1/2 = 0.5

When your attack speed increases by 100%, your time between attacks goes down by 50%. 100% haste on a 2.6 attack speed weapon will give you 1.3 attack speed, not 0(which would break the game obviously)
